QuoteOriginally posted by leekil Quote
I particularly like the fifth one of the trees and the fog. What happened in the third one -- what is that blue artifact on the bottom right?

I didn't think the rules said you had to use the lens that came with the camera, but maybe I've forgotten them by this point?
Thank you, the tree and fog shot was my favorite from the day, too.

The blue artifact is something that CN200 does. The first few frames of every roll are usually red-fogged because the film lacks an antihalation layer to protect it from light leaking through the cassette mouth. But CN200 is notorious for other weird glitches. The blue spot looks like a dye run, where an area of dye didn't clear. It could have been a flaw in the dye layer or an are where the dye was a bit thicker and didn't fully clear. It's definitely not the weirdest thing that I've seen CN200 do.

As for the rules, I can't recall any more. But I actually don't care if anyone uses more than just the fast 50.
